程序员想转行的原因多种多样,以下是一些主要的因素:
行业变化与技术迭代
新技术层出不穷:信息技术行业变化迅速,新技术不断涌现,老技术迅速被淘汰。程序员需要不断学习新技术和工具以保持竞争力,这种高强度的学习节奏可能让一些人感到压力巨大。
技术迭代速度快:技术更新换代的速度非常快,程序员需要不断适应新的开发要求和市场需求,这对一些学习能力较弱的人来说可能是一个挑战。
工作压力与生活平衡
工作强度大:程序员常常需要处理紧急项目,加班加点成为常态,长时间的高强度工作会对个人的身心健康造成严重影响。
生活与工作的平衡:为了寻求更好的生活质量和工作与生活的平衡,一些程序员选择转行,希望能够摆脱高压的工作环境。
职业生涯规划与发展
重复性工作:编程工作中重复性较强的部分可能会让一些程序员感到厌倦。
职业发展前景:随着职业生涯的发展,程序员开始思考个人的长远规划,对于自己所在领域的发展前景感到担忧也是促使他们转行的原因之一。
健康和家庭因素:随着年龄的增长,一些程序员开始考虑健康和家庭因素,愿意选择更稳定、压力相对较小的工作环境。
新兴行业的吸引
新兴行业发展迅速:新兴行业如人工智能、大数据、区块链等呈现出巨大的发展潜力,吸引了很多程序员转行去从事这些领域的工作。
薪资和福利待遇:一些程序员可能发现在其他行业也能够获得相似或更好的待遇,或者由于长时间坐姿工作导致身体不适,因此选择转行。
个人兴趣和天赋
兴趣变化:有些程序员可能发现自己对编程不再有兴趣,或者发现其他领域更符合自己的兴趣和天赋。
市场竞争与就业压力
市场竞争激烈:随着越来越多的人加入编程领域,市场上供大于求,使得编程人员的就业压力增大。
技术能力不足:一些程序员可能因为技术能力不足而被淘汰,从而选择转行。
综上所述,程序员想转行的原因是多方面的,包括行业变化、工作压力、职业规划、新兴行业的吸引以及个人兴趣和市场需求等。每个人的情况不同,转行的动机也可能有所差异。